An easy, trimmed lawn used to come at a slow pace and without the lovely stripe patterns that many people are looking for. A decent result, but if the technology needed to improve performance already exists, why not apply it?

High precision global navigation satellite system (GNSS) technology, like u-blox’s ZED-F9R module, is levelling up the robotic mowing industry, delivering centimeter-level positioning accuracies.
